Job description

We are an Established Pioneering Durian Cultivation Company involved in the integrated cultivation and retailing operations. We are looking for a capable and results-driven candidate to join our management team as a SENIOR AGRONOMIST.

This position and portfolio is responsible for overseeing and driving agronomic planning, execution, and continuous improvement across our Durian Plantation. This role involves leading field trials, developing and implementing comprehensive agrochemical and fertilizer programs, and ensuring optimal crop performance through effective monitoring of soil health, irrigation systems, and pest and disease conditions. The incumbent will play a key role in translating research findings into practical field applications, while providing technical and agronomy leadership, guidance, and training to the agronomist team and operation plantation teams.

Key Responsibilities:-

Provide overall agronomy leadership through the various stages of a durian tree phenological stages/phases, which encompasses post-harvest recuperation, vegetative, flower induction, flowering, pollination, and fruit development.

Lead, manage, and execute field trials, including tree growth monitoring, agronomy treatment implementation, and evaluation of outcomes.

Develop and oversee end-to-end agrochemical and fertilizer programs, including annual planning, scheduling, and budget control.

Monitor and analyse crop performance, soil health, irrigation systems, and pest and disease conditions to ensure optimal plantation productivity.

Supervise and guide the agronomist team, supervisors, and operation field teams in executing treatments, ensuring proper application and follow‑up actions.

Maintain accurate and comprehensive records of agronomic activities, including trial data, laboratory inventories, and environmental indicators.

Drive research and development initiatives, translating findings into practical field applications and continuous improvement of agronomic practices.

Provide technical advisory and training to plantation colleagues, while ensuring compliance with SOPs, sustainability, and environmental standards and certification requirements.

Support team management and operational effectiveness, including resource planning, performance monitoring, and reporting to management.

Bachelor’s Degree or higher (Master/PHD) in Agronomy, Crop Science, Horticulture, or related field.

Proficient in Bahasa Malaysia and English; Mandarin is an added advantage for stakeholder Management.

Minimum 7-8 years of relevant experience in medium to large-scale durian plantation operations.

Prior experiences should include the entire phenological stages of the durian tree, i.e., post-harvest recuperation, vegetative, flower induction, flowering, pollination, and fruit development.

Proven ability to conduct comprehensive field assessments and implement effective solutions to agronomic challenges.

Advanced and integrated understanding of crop nutrition, Integrated Pest Management (IPM), soil health, irrigation systems, and post-harvest handling.

Proven ability to handle aspects of agronomy certifications such as MyGAP and/or Malaysia Best.
